Earthquake hits Pakistan, killing 170
|
|
A strong earthquake struck before dawn Oct. 29 in southwestern Pakistan, killing at least 170 people. Around 15,000 people were left homeless, and rescuers were digging for survivors in a remote valley in Baluchistan, the province bordering Afghanistan where the magnitude-6.4 quake struck. (AP)
